Factorial Design
A research strategy in experiments that evaluates the interaction between multiple factors and their combined impact on the outcome.
Repeated Measures Design
An experimental design in which the same subjects are exposed to each condition or treatment, allowing direct comparison of different treatments on the same subjects.
Factorial Design
A type of experimental design that allows researchers to examine the effect of two or more variables simultaneously by changing them together, not just one at a time.
Participants
Individuals who take part in a research study, often providing data through their behavior, responses, or physiological reactions.
